Abstract :
Pervasive computing is the vision of technology that is invisibly embedded in our natural surroundings. Users are offered unobtrusive services that require minimal attention. In this paper the Awareness and Notification Service (ANS) is presented that enables to rapidly build applications that inform users about their environment. Additionally, the service offers notifications tailored to the user´s preferences and current context. ANS takes a rule based approach based on the event-condition-action pattern. Users specify when and what should be notified to them by using a convenient ANS rule language. This flexible mechanism allows to rapidly develop applications that provide context-aware notifications without the need to write programming code to activate rules, nor to implement personalized notifications
